Transaction e311bc414679bf770ebf57579f1f54823be95f61c69144cdc8dc2b3f7195bda6

4 Input
2 Outputs
  • e311bc414679bf770ebf57579f1f54823be95f61c69144cdc8dc2b3f7195bda6:0
  • value  3417410
    address  1EcmFLKBoQTow1MFoa76cFTtVHBTrLXuHx
  • e311bc414679bf770ebf57579f1f54823be95f61c69144cdc8dc2b3f7195bda6:1
  • value  30000000
    address  1PEUanNK7uQXzDfvupEoDGZveb8n9YueHL